Rossignol PS 10L Rucksack / Backpack is the baby brother to the PS 21L and as fine a back country daypack as you will find. It is a 10 liter low volume design and a top loading rucksack. PS stands for Pro Series Harness system. A Rossignol trademark, this is the wavy shaped panel that comes out of each side of the pack and connects to the compression straps. In addition to very efficient pack compression, these straps are useful in lashing on skis or snowboards. This backpack has separate systems for carrying skis, snowboards, shovels and probes. One of the PS 10's main features is the drop down back panel that allows insertion of a snowboard for horizontal portage. The main advantage of this is that the weight of the deck is low over the hips, and does not wear on the shoulders. And, it is Camelbak compatible. There is a separate hanging compartment inside all of the packs that holds up to an 80 ounce hydration bag. A pass through hole at the top of the bag and velcro straps on either side of the shoulder straps to route and secure the hydration system delivery tube. The pack has a brushed nylon (soft) eyewear compartment and key ring clip. The material is 600D coated fabric with 840D nylon reinforced bottom. It closes with the Speed Lace System which is Rossignol's patented one tug total pack compression system. It is built with the Pro Series Compression Harness. The shoulder pads and back panels are closed cell EVA foam for continuing comfort. The adjustable sternum strap is elastic and this pack has shoulder strap load levelers. The hip belt is wide. Rossignol's System 2 reinforced suspension system fits the anatomical curve of the back and gives you a precision fit on the shoulders and hips. The narrowing shape of the pack at the top of the bag improves pack stability. System 2 is Rossignol's code name for the suspension system that among other things features 2 large oval shaped pads that both cushion the load but holds the bag away from your back to allow better ventilation when hiking. And the materials and design make a pack that is light in weight and durable. The up-haul loop is at the top of every pack Rossignol makes. It is simply a loop to pick up the bag.
